The fun dies after a while July 13, 2008 1 out of 1 found this review helpful
My little sister got this toy and it was really fun... for the first month or so. Now it's just collecting dust in my brother's bedroom. We did have one problem with the 1st one she got. The color went away and it was black and white and the sound went wacko. The batteries were fresh so we knew th problem was in the game, and we ended up returning it and getting a new one. We have had no problems with it exept, as I said earlier, she's lost interest in it and it's now collecting dust in my brother's bedroom. She's 8 years old, so I understand why she lost interest so fast. Like the other reviews say: It's too basic.

Too basic, targeted for small children. January 7, 2008 Running Late 0 out of 2 found this review helpful
I purchased this game for may daughter. She previously owned other plug-in games, but this one was just too basic for her. I think this is for small children, maybe less than 6. She had outgrown this game.
